The stuff that Jason talked about is much, much more important to me than
anything else that I've seen discussed regarding gnue-sb.  As a consultant,
I have no inventory other than my time.  The areas I'm concerned about
include general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, expenses
(especially including travel), fixed assets (which I need to record for
paying state business "personal property" taxes), and balance sheet items
(which I also need for the personal property tax form).
